## Runbook: Quillback Circuit Breaker

When the upstream Ferrowave API exceeds a 30% error rate over five minutes, the breaker trips and requests are served from the fallback cache. To confirm the trip, check the `breaker_state` gauge on the Quillback dashboard. State transitions are also logged to the operational database for audit. Inspect recent transitions by connecting with the following:

warehouse DSN: postgresql://kasax_svc:qKMoO2AkuKwZ23@db-b256.kelviio.example:5432/framir

## Broker Upgrade: Fennelwire 4.2

This step upgrades the Fennelwire message broker on the Thornbay cluster. Drain consumers first via `fw-admin drain --all`, then confirm queue depth is zero on the ops dashboard. Snapshot the journal volume before replacing the broker binaries; rollback without it takes roughly two hours. Once the new binaries are staged, the deployment must be authorized by signing the upgrade manifest. The release manager signs the manifest using the deploy key below.

rollout seal: bky4_x7Gc

## Deploying the Gatewick Proctor Queue

Deploys are pretty painless: push to main, wait for the pipeline, then watch the queue drain dashboard for five minutes. If candidates pile up mid-exam, roll back first and ask questions later — the queue replays safely. Everything the workers care about lives in one config block, shown here for reference.

settings of bafof-yagef:
JOROX_PIN=8740
JOROX_TENANT=pelox
JOROX_METRICS_HOST=metrics.jorox.qorvelworks.internal
JOROX_SEAL=seal_c78f63c1
JOROX_STANDBY_TEAM=norax

Handover: vendored third-party fonts

Handing off the font vendoring work for the Larkspur plugin SDK. All third-party fonts are now checked into the assets tree with license files alongside, so plugin builds no longer fetch them at build time. Plugin authors should reference fonts by the vendored alias, not by family name, since names can collide across versions. The resolver maps aliases to files using the configuration that follows.

deployment values, faduf-tawep:
SORDOR_LOG_LEVEL=error
SORDOR_METRICS_HOST=metrics.sordor.nelvrolabs.internal
SORDOR_POOL_SIZE=4